Hunters Haven #3 at Rustic Ridge
Custom built log cabins bordered by the Black Hills National Forest and just minutes from many of our areas most scenic attractions including Mt. Rushmore, Crazy Horse, Custer State Park, Bear Country Reptile Gardens, Caves, Shopping, Art Galleries, Wineries, Dining, Golfing and Mini Golfing, Hiking, Biking, Hunting and so much more!
Our cozy log cabins are located on 2.3 acres of natural Black Hills beauty. They come furnished with kitchenettes, including , dishes, utensils, refrigerator-freezer, microwave, toaster, electric skillet and coffee pot. Each cabin has its own unique mountain setting and is a cozy retreat with all the comforts of home. All of our cabins are custom built and accented with log railing and many other custom log accents. Each cabin sleeps 2-6 people comfortably.
Our cabins have a covered porch, A/C, Satellite TV, Charcoal grill and picnic areas. We are just minutes away from more than a dozen of the Black Hills most popular and scenic attractions.
Onsite firepit and childrens play center.
Our prices include all fees. No hidden fees.
